Why a PCI Express Adapter SSD Is Necessary

From my experience, upgrading to a PCI Express (PCIe) adapter SSD has been a game-changer for my computer’s performance. Unlike traditional SATA SSDs, PCIe SSDs connect directly to the motherboard’s high-speed PCIe lanes, allowing for much faster data transfer rates. This means my system boots up quicker, applications load almost instantly, and file transfers happen in a fraction of the time. If you rely on speed and efficiency, this upgrade is essential.

Another reason I found a PCIe adapter SSD necessary is the improved bandwidth and lower latency it offers. For tasks like video editing, gaming, or running virtual machines, every millisecond counts. The PCIe interface drastically reduces bottlenecks, making my workflow smoother and more responsive. Plus, many modern motherboards have limited M.2 slots, so using a PCIe adapter allows me to add high-speed storage without sacrificing other components.

Ultimately, investing in a PCI Express adapter SSD feels like future-proofing my setup. It ensures I’m not held back by slower storage technology and gives me the flexibility to expand my system’s capabilities. My Buying Guides on ‘Pci Express Adapter Ssd’

When I first decided to upgrade my computer’s storage, I realized that a PCI Express (PCIe) adapter SSD could be a game-changer in terms of speed and performance. If you’re considering the same, here’s my personal guide to help you choose the right PCIe adapter SSD that fits your needs.

Understanding What a PCI Express Adapter SSD Is

Before diving into buying, I made sure to understand what exactly a PCIe adapter SSD does. Essentially, it’s a device that allows you to connect an M.2 NVMe SSD to your desktop’s PCIe slot. This is especially useful if your motherboard doesn’t have an M.2 slot or if you want to add multiple NVMe drives for faster data access.

Check Compatibility With Your System

One of the first things I checked was whether my motherboard supports PCIe adapter SSDs. Some older motherboards might not support NVMe booting or might have limited PCIe lanes. I looked up my motherboard’s manual and confirmed the PCIe version and lane availability. Also, I made sure the adapter physically fits in the case and that my power supply can handle any additional power needs.

Choose the Right SSD Type

When selecting the SSD to pair with the adapter, I considered the NVMe standard and the form factor. Most PCIe adapters support M.2 NVMe SSDs, but some also support SATA M.2 drives. For the best speed, I went with an NVMe SSD because it utilizes PCIe lanes directly. I also looked at the SSD’s capacity, read/write speeds, endurance, and brand reputation.

Look for Quality and Features in the Adapter

Not all PCIe adapters are created equal. I prioritized adapters with good build quality, heat dissipation features like heatsinks, and secure mounting options for the SSD. Some adapters come with additional features like BIOS compatibility switches or multiple M.2 slots, which can be handy if you want to expand storage further.

Consider PCIe Version and Lane Configuration

PCIe versions (3.0, 4.0, 5.0) and lane configurations (x1, x4, x8) affect the speed of your SSD. I made sure to pick an adapter that supports at least PCIe 3.0 x4 lanes to fully utilize the SSD’s speed. If your motherboard and SSD support PCIe 4.0, then a compatible adapter can significantly boost performance.

Budget vs Performance

I balanced my budget with the performance I wanted. High-end adapters with heatsinks and multiple slots cost more but offer better durability and expandability. If you’re on a budget, there are simpler adapters that still get the job done well. Just avoid very cheap models without cooling as SSDs can throttle under heat.

Installation and Driver Support

I checked if the adapter required any special drivers or BIOS updates. Most PCIe adapters work plug-and-play, but some older systems might need BIOS tweaks to recognize the drive as a boot device. Watching installation guides or videos can help ensure a smooth setup.
